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ING
08/24/20121
 Stopped do to heavy traffic and started smelling exhaust in cab. pulled off on next exist opened hood and drivers side of engine was smoking. coughing and lung discomfort. found some shade to let truck cool. noticed black color on rear of exhaust manifold, looked closer and missing bolt in same area of manifold. looking online lots of complaints of same problem but no recalls. should be emissions recall and safety recall in my case. *tr
POWER TRAIN - A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ION
11/28/200952000
 Tl*the contact owns a 2005 chevrolet k2500 pickup truck. while driving 5 mph the vehicle shifted into neutral gear while it was in drive. he then tried to shift gears and was unable to do so. the engine was revving after he tried to change gears and within a few minutes, he was able to continue driving normally. the dealer was contacted and stated that the warranty expired and made no repairs to the vehicle. the vehicle was repaired by another mechanic at the owners expense. the failure mileage was 52,000 and the current mileage was 54,000. updated 04/01/10. *lj
S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C
11/30/201158600
 When trying to turn at an intersection, the brakes on my 2500hd with duramax diesel applied without driver using the pedal. this happened at every turn while trying to get to the repair shop. the shop replaced the factory sealed hydraulic booster assembly. after 1500 miles the problem has not recurred. we have contacted general motors, but since there was no recall, there is nothing they will do. this same condition happened at 30000 miles, but cleared up and no dealer could find a defect code and could not duplicate the problem. hopefully, this does not happen again at high speed.
